INDUSTRY NEWS NIH Awards $10M to Einstein for Diabetes Research The National Institute of Diabetes and Digestive and Kidney Diseases of the National Institutes of Health (NIH) has awarded Albert Einstein College of Medicine of Yeshiva University a five-year, $9.5 million grant for the continuation of its Diabetes Research and Training Center. [Albert Einstein College of Medicine of Yeshiva University Press Release] NOXXON Pharma AG raises 33 Million Euros in Series D Round NOXXON Pharma AG announced the successful closing of a 33 million Euros Series D round of financing. The funds raised will be used primarily for the ongoing clinical and pre-clinical development of NOXXON´s lead products NOX-E36, NOX-A12, and NOX-H94 in the fields of diabetic complications, oncology and hematology. [NOXXON Pharma AG Press Release] NewLink Initiates Pivotal Phase III Clinical Trial Of HyperAcute®-Pancreas Immunotherapy For Resected Pancreatic Cancer NewLink Genetics Corporation announced treatment of the first patient in a nationwide Phase III clinical trial of its HyperAcute®-Pancreas cancer immunotherapy for patients who have successfully undergone pancreatic surgical resection. [PR Newswire] Repligen Announces FDA and EMA Approval of Re-Analysis of Images from Phase III Trial of RG1068 for Pancreatic Imaging Repligen Corporation announced that the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) and the European Medicines Agency (EMA) have approved the Company’s proposal to re-analyze the images from our Phase III study to establish the utility of RG1068, synthetic human secretin, in improving magnetic resonance imaging of the pancreas. POLICY NEWS Third Time’s a Charm for COMPETES Bill By a vote of 262 to 150, legislators authorized $84 billion for research, education, and innovation programs over the next 5 years at the National Science Foundation, the Department of Energy, and two Department of Commerce agencies-NOAA and NIST under the America COMPETES Reauthorization Act (HR 5116). [House of Representatives, United States] Democrats: FDA Should Be Able to Recall Drugs House Democrats repeatedly called for federal regulators to be given the authority to recall drugs. Pending legislation would grant that power to the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for food, but not for drugs. [House of Representatives, United States] Congress Considers Synthetic Biology Risks, Benefits Anthony Fauci, director of the National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Diseases, said that the government is moving quickly to bring synthetic biology under review by two existing panels that have done a good job of monitoring cutting-edge research in the past. [U.S. House of Representatives Committee on Energy and Commerce, United States] Last Hurrah from National Academies Stem Cell Committee Even though the National Institutes of Health issued stem cell guidelines last year, there’s still a need for guidelines for research that remains off-limits for U.S. government-funded labs. [National Academies’ National Research Council and Institute of Medicine, United States] NIH Set to Tighten Financial Rules for Researchers After a wave of financial scandals over the past few years involving biomedical researchers, the U.S. National Institutes of Health (NIH) proposed far-reaching changes that would lead to tighter oversight of agency-funded extramural investigators and their institutions.
